Abstract
A digital data transmission system by modulating a coherent light wave is provided using modulation of the MSFK type with N frequencies for modulating the light wave. The transmitter comprises a coherent light source, a modulator, an output optical means and an MSFK modulation signal generator. The receiver comprises an input optical means, local light wave source and a heterodyne mixer for creating an electric signal of intermediate frequency. A demodulation and detection circuit comprises filtering means for separately selecting the N frequencies before detection. A processing cirucit puts the data back into its initial form. A circuit for compensating for the drift of the light sources is used for preserving lock on to the intermediate frequency.
